About This Home

$1,400 deposit, Available Now

Welcome to this beautifully newly renovated 3-bedroom, 2-bath home located in a quiet, peaceful community. Featuring a thoughtfully updated interior with modern finishes, this home offers a comfortable and functional layout perfect for everyday living. Enjoy spacious bedrooms, refreshed bathrooms, and an open, inviting living area ideal for relaxing or entertaining. Step outside to a fully fenced yard—perfect for pets, play, or outdoor gatherings. The serene neighborhood setting provides a sense of privacy while still being conveniently located near local amenities.

1636 N Sherman Ave is a house located in Greene County and the 65803 ZIP Code. This area is served by the Springfield R-Xii School District attendance zone.

City - Springfield

Welcome to Springfield, Missouri, where small-city convenience meets Ozark Mountain charm. As the "Queen City of the Ozarks," Springfield offers an array of rental options from downtown lofts to suburban apartments. The rental market remains affordable, with one-bedroom apartments averaging $862 monthly, showing a 4.5% annual increase. The historic Rountree district features character-rich streets, while University Heights and Phelps Grove offer a mix of classic and contemporary housing options near Missouri State University's campus.

Downtown Springfield centers around Park Central Square, home to the restored 1926 Gillioz Theatre. The Springfield Botanical Gardens at Nathanael Greene Park includes the Mizumoto Japanese Stroll Garden, offering peaceful walks among traditional landscaping. The city houses the Bass Pro Shops national headquarters and the connected Wonders of Wildlife Museum & Aquarium.
